Abstract

A system configured to enable remote control to allow a first user to provide assistance to a second user. The system may receive a command from the second user granting remote control to the first user, enabling the first user to initiate a voice command on behalf of the second user. In some examples, the system may enable the remote control by treating a voice command originating from the first user as though it originated from the second user instead. For example, the system may receive the voice command from a first device associated with the first user but may route the voice command as though it was received by a second device associated with the second user. To enable this functionality, during a remote control session the first device may disable wakeword detection so that the voice command is correctly routed to the second device.
